本文作者:交换机

vba系统开发模板,vba系统开发模板怎么用

交换机 昨天 7
vba系统开发模板,vba系统开发模板怎么用摘要: 大家好,今天小编关注到一个比较有意思的话题,就是关于vba系统开发模板的问题,于是小编就整理了4个相关介绍vba系统开发模板的解答,让我们一起看看吧。vba怎么调用模板?如何使用V...

大家好,今天小编关注到一个比较意思的话题,就是关于vba系统开发模板问题,于是小编就整理了4个相关介绍vba系统开发模板的解答,让我们一起看看吧。

  1. vba怎么调用模板?
  2. 如何使用VBA调用outlook发送邮件源码?
  3. excel vba 设置整个工作表的数据格式代码?
  4. Excel中如何用VBA快速创建日报表模板?

vba怎么调用模板?

VBA 模板调用有两种方式
1、使用application.VBE.ActiveVBProject.VBComponents.AddFromTemplate方法,并指定模板文件的路径;
2、使用Application.FileTemplateProperty("模板文件路径")方法获取模板的内容然后使用Application.VBE.ActiveVBProject.VBComponents.Import方法将模板的内容写入新的VBComponent中。

如何使用VBA调用outlook发送邮件源码?

调用VBA的FSO,用户界面使用excel

vba系统开发模板,vba系统开发模板怎么用
图片来源网络,侵删)

这里做一个简单展示,excel界面如下。(如果邮件正文复杂的话,就要用word的邮件合并功能了)

我只要在A列填入姓名,H列和I列填入日期和时间,其他部分由excel公式自动产生。点选发送键(send 键),则列表中的邮件被自动群发。公式如下

excel背后是VBA代码。因为代码是网络上搜索的,这里就不贴了。代码可以参考

Send Mass Email from Excel VBA 1.3 - Multiple Recipients - In Outlook

vba系统开发模板,vba系统开发模板怎么用
(图片来源网络,侵删)

excel vba 设置整个工作表的数据格式代码?

打开EXCEL,在选项修改默认新建的文件为1个工作表(没修改默认新建的文件是3个工作表)。然后删除SHEET2\SHEET3,将SHEE1全选,设置好行高20、列宽10、对齐等自己需要的属性。选文件另存为,保存类型选择“EXCEL模板”,文件名和位置有两种情况。

(1)如果这台电脑基本上是自己用,可以选择默认的NORMAL模板的位置,替换NORMAL模板,这样每次点开EXCEL就是你想要的。

(2)如果这台电脑是几人共用的,就自己选个位置取个名字,每次要打开EXCEL时,直接点你保存的这个模板文件名就行了。这样不影响别人使用习惯。

vba系统开发模板,vba系统开发模板怎么用
(图片来源网络,侵删)

不在电脑旁边,可能描述有些不准确,但是思路应该是这样。

Excel中如何用VBA快速创建日报表模板?

谢谢邀请,实现这个功能只需要一串VBA代码即可。具体操作步骤,可以关注头条号1017课堂,在历史文章里,查看 只需三行代码,一秒钟自动生成整个月的报告模板。

代码如下:

Sub 批量制作模板()

Dim i As Integer

For i = 1 To 31

Sheet1.Copy after:=Sheets(Sheets.Count)

Sheets(Sheets.Count).Name = "1月" & i & "日"

Sheets(Sheets.Count).Range("e3") = "2018-01-" & i

Next

End Sub

到此,以上就是小编对于vba系统开发模板的问题就介绍到这了,希望介绍关于vba系统开发模板的4点解答对大家有用。

文章版权及转载声明

[免责声明]本文来源于网络,不代表本站立场,如转载内容涉及版权等问题,请联系邮箱:83115484@qq.com,我们会予以删除相关文章,保证您的权利。转载请注明出处:http://www.nbdaiqile.com/post/88020.html发布于 昨天

阅读
分享